Expected Behaviors
The actions or reactions anticipated in a particular group or situation according to societal norms or social standards.
Gender Roles
Social and behavioral norms that are considered appropriate for individuals of a given gender within a particular culture or society.
Secondary Sex Characteristics
Physical features that appear during puberty, distinguishing male and female bodies but are not directly involved in reproduction.
Gender Role
A set of expected behaviors, attitudes, and traits for males or for females.
